WebFeb 17, 2024 · Apply the leather preparer. Rub the leather preparer or de-glazer on with a clean cloth. This removes the leather finish so the dye can penetrate evenly into the material. 6 Wet the leather. Use a spray bottle filled with water to dampen the surface of the leather. Do not over-saturate the leather, but make sure you have an even covering.

WebJul 9, 2015 · One of the easiest ways to stiffen leather is to let it dry out. We’ve talked about this before on the LeatherCult blog, but it’s worth mentioning again that leather contains thousands upon thousands of small, microscopic pores that are constantly absorbing and releasing moisture.
